The Rockford Files: Friends and Foul Play (1996)

The Rockford Files: Friends and Foul Play (1996) poster

An friend of Jim's continues to seek his help for her murdered son, but when she winds up dead not long after an altercation with the mafia man, Jim must must do what it takes to put both her soul and her son's, at rest, himself.

Director: Stuart Margolin
Genre: Mystery, TV Movie, Crime
Runtime: 120 min
